## Service Accounts — Trailmark Offline Mode

The Trailmark field-survey app queues observations locally and syncs when connectivity returns. Sync jobs run under the `trailmark-sync` service account, which authenticates to the Basinport ingestion service. If the queue backs up past 12 hours, on-call should manually trigger a flush from the sync console. Manual flushes require the service account's active key, shown below.

service key, fawip-bajef: kto11_Qt5wZK9vdNC

## Changelog — Quillbill Renderer v3.2.0

Hey, welcome aboard! Quick heads-up on what changed in this release of the Quillbill PDF invoice renderer. We flipped a few defaults that tripped people up constantly: page size now defaults to A4 instead of Letter, embedded fonts are on by default, and the margin preset went from "compact" to "standard." If a client complains about layout shifts, this release is probably why. For reference while you're onboarding, the new default configuration shipping with v3.2.0 is listed below.

settings of kadug-taweg:
wenath:
  pin: 8742
  metrics_host: metrics.wenath.tolvaqlabs.internal
  tenant: novael
  seal: seal_4bc36aba

Subject: Quickstore 4.2 — bloom filter now fronts the KV layer

Plugin authors: starting with this release, Quickstore places a bloom filter ahead of the key-value store. Negative lookups return faster; false positives fall through safely. No API changes are required on your side. Verify your plugin against the staging build referenced below.

session token of fahif-tadup = htk3_9c7

## TICKET: Drift in StormRelay fan-out config

For discussion at the weekly eng sync. StormRelay fans out severe-weather alerts to regional subscriber queues. Comparing prod against the declared manifest, I found the batch size, retry ceiling, and two queue bindings have drifted — likely from the manual tuning during the Hailsworth storm surge. Before we reconcile, we should agree on which side wins. The current live values are recorded below.

deployment values, kajep-kageg:
[praix]
host = praix.paliqcorp.corp
user = praix_svc
database = praix_prod